THE INDIAN EVIDENCE (AMENDMENT) ACT, 2002.
ACT NO. 4 OF 2003.
[31st December, 2002.]
An Act further to amend the Indian Evidence Act, 1872.
BE it enacted by Parliament in the Fifty-third Year of the Republic of India as follows:-
1.Short title.
This Act may be called the Indian Evidence (Amendment) Act, 2002.
2.Amendment of section 146.
In section 146 of the Indian Evidence Act, 1872 (1 of 1872) (hereinafter referred to as the principal Act), after clause (3), the following proviso shall be inserted, namely:-
"Provided that in a prosecution for rape or attempt to commit rape, it shall not be permissible to put questions in the cross-examination of the prosecutrix as to her general immoral character.".
3.Amendment of section 155.
In section 155 of the principal Act, clause (4) shall be omitted.
